Here is one $5 Scenario for the week of January 9th:
*coupons in red
Transaction #1
Buy 1 Motrin PM @ $3.00
Buy 1 Tylenol Precise @ $5.00
– $6.00/2 Tylenol Precise and more (SS insert 1/9/11)
Total After Coupon = $2.00
+UP Rewards earned= $2.00 for Motrin and $3.00 For Tylenol
Transaction #2
Buy 2 Quaker Instant Oatmeal @ $2.50 each
– (2) $1.00/1 Quaker Oatmeal (SS insert 1/2/11)
Pay with $3.00 +UP Rewards from above
Total After Coupons and +UP Rewards= $0.00
+UP Rewards earned $2.00
Grand Total OOP= $3.00
Total Value= $13.00 with $4.00 +UP Rewards remaining.
